LiveKit is building the infrastructure layer for the voice-driven era of computing. Our platform gives developers everything they need to build, test, deploy, scale, and observe agents in production. Founded in 2021, LiveKit powers voice AI applications for OpenAI, xAI, Salesforce, Coursera, Spotify, and thousands of others, collectively facilitating billions of calls each year.

About This Role:

Are you passionate about shaping the future of physical AI and robotics? We’re looking for a talented engineer to join the Robotics team. We are building the infrastructure and tools to connect robots, operators, and data pipelines in the cloud. If you're eager to make a lasting impact, we want to hear from you!

What You'll Do:
  • Design and develop core functionalities for our SDKs with a focus on robotics and embedded applications

  • Work with customers to understand how to cleanly integrate LiveKit features into their platforms

  • Write clear documentation and examples for users

  • Work with C++, Rust, Python, and other languages

Who You Are:
  • Experienced C++ engineer with a passion for robotics & embedded systems

  • Experience working with Rust & building on top of Rust using FFI in various languages

  • Experience working with embedded linux platforms such as Nvidia Jetson

  • Experience working with robot middleware frameworks such as ROS2, Copper-rs, Dora, lerobot

  • You are skilled at navigating complex systems

What you need to know about the Austin Tech Scene

Austin has a diverse and thriving tech ecosystem thanks to home-grown companies like Dell and major campuses for IBM, AMD and Apple. The state’s flagship university, the University of Texas at Austin, is known for its engineering school, and the city is known for its annual South by Southwest tech and media conference. Austin’s tech scene spans many verticals, but it’s particularly known for hardware, including semiconductors, as well as AI, biotechnology and cloud computing. And its food and music scene, low taxes and favorable climate has made the city a destination for tech workers from across the country.

Key Facts About Austin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 180,500; 13.7%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Dell, IBM, AMD, Apple, Alphabet
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, hardware, cloud computing, software, healthtech
  • Funding Landscape: $4.5 billion in VC fun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Live Oak Ventures, Austin Ventures, Hinge Capital, Gigafund, KdT Ventures, Next Coast Ventures, Silverton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of Texas, Southwestern University, Texas State University, Center for Complex Quantum Systems, Oden Institute for Computational Engineering and Sciences, Texas Advanced Computing Center
